arm cortex m0+ interrupts enable/disable

Question asked by Alex Leonte on Aug 25, 2015
Latest reply on Jun 29, 2017 by Wei Gao



I was wondering what is the difference between this two methods for disabling interrupts


1.CPSID causes interrupts to be disabled by setting PRIMASK.

2.Disable all Device-specific interrupts writing in NVIC->ICER[0] + Disable System exceptions (example SysTick - timer and interrupt)